## Sensor drift: what to do at 3am

If the GrowLoop controller starts reporting humidity swings that don't match the backup probes in the Fernwick greenhouse, it's almost always sensor drift, not an actual climate event. Don't panic and don't touch the vents manually. First, restart the calibration daemon and give it ten minutes to re-baseline. If readings still disagree by more than 5%, flip the controller into safe mode. The safe-mode thresholds it will use are these.

config for yahap-bajof:
[istix]
host = istix.qorvelsys.internal
user = istix_svc
database = istix_prod

Subject: Key rotation — Pickroute optimizer service

Maintainers,

The credential used by the Pickroute optimizer to query the Binward slotting service rotates this Friday. The optimizer recalculates pick-list sequencing hourly, so a stale key will silently degrade routes to the fallback heuristic. Update the deployment config and restart the scheduler pod after the swap. Rotation cadence remains quarterly going forward.

The replacement key is below.

— Warehouse Systems

app token of yajeg-kawef = kto11_7En3XSX8xQw

### Step 4: Enable EXIF scrubbing

All uploads through the Fernlock ingest path must pass the ScrubJay filter before storage. Legacy images already in the Marrowbin bucket are reprocessed by the backfill job; new uploads are scrubbed inline. GPS, serial, and owner tags are stripped; orientation is preserved. Verify the filter rejects on parse failure rather than passing through. Apply the service configuration exactly as shown below.

config for yawep-tajef:
[kelion]
team = kelys
access_code = ac_1a130d
owner = holax.aldmir
host = kelion.urlaqforge.example
port = 9090
peer = fenmir.lumicio.example
salt = d0dd3cb5
pin = 3295

Meeting notes, Records Team, loans review: the three ceramic pieces on loan from the Haverlund Collection to the Ostmere Gallery will be collected Friday by Quillbrook Couriers. Condition reports must be photographed and filed before crates are sealed. Insurance paperwork travels with the lead crate only. The courier is to complete the hand-over strictly per the line that follows.

drop instructions, bagug-kagup: the rusath julmir courier leaves the ralwyn aldok eliius ledger at gate 8603 under passcode 993062